Luxury Spas and Signature Massages
First stop: the top‑rated spas. Talise Spa at Madinat Jumeirah offers a blend of Middle‑Eastern aromatherapy and western techniques. Book a 90‑minute signature ritual for a steam, massage, and facial combo that leaves you feeling lighter than a desert breeze.
If you love Thai traditions, head to Thai Massage Dubai on Al Wasl Road. Their therapists use deep‑pressure stretches that target tight back muscles—perfect after a day of desert touring. Ask for the “Gold Leaf” package: a 120‑minute session with herbal compresses and a foot scrub.
For a more comprehensive approach, try a Full Body Massage at Talise or Six Senses Spa. These treatments combine Swedish, deep‑tissue, and reflexology, delivering relief from both physical tension and mental stress.
Home Massage and Mobile Wellness
When you’d rather stay in, Dubai’s home‑massage services bring professional therapists to your door. Companies like Home Massage Dubai let you pick the style—Swedish for gentle relaxation, deep‑tissue for stubborn knots, or aromatherapy for a calming scent.
Booking is easy: choose a time slot, describe any problem areas, and the therapist arrives with a portable table, fresh linens, and sanitized oils. This option works well for early mornings before work or late evenings after a night out.
Mobile wellness isn’t limited to massage. Several providers also offer on‑site yoga, meditation, and even sound‑bath sessions. A 45‑minute session in your living room can reset your nervous system faster than a crowded club.
Chill Spots Beyond Spas
Relaxation isn’t just about treatments. Dubai’s quieter beach clubs—like White Beach Club—offer loungers, soft music, and sunset views without the party crowd. Grab a fresh coconut water, lay back, and let the waves do the work.
If you prefer an indoor oasis, try the Dubai Creek Harbour Boardwalk. Walk along the water, find a shaded bench, and enjoy the soft hum of the city below. It’s a perfect spot for a quick mental reset between meetings.
For night‑time calm, the rooftop bar at At.mosphere offers panoramic city lights and a chilled atmosphere. Order a herbal tea instead of a cocktail, and let the height give you a fresh perspective.
Finally, don’t underestimate the power of a simple stroll in Al Barsha Pond Park. The walking path, gentle lake, and occasional joggers create a low‑key environment that encourages slow breathing and clear thoughts.
